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Fairhill Apartments

What is the Cheapest apartment in Fairhill with 2 Bedroom?

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in Fairhill is at 1515 N. 16th listed at $700.

How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Fairhill Apartment?

The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Fairhill is $1,480.

What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Fairhill Apartment for rent?

Today's apartment with the most square footage in Fairhill is a 1,100 square feet unit starting from $1,699 at Berks Reserve - Suites @The Reserve.

What is the average size for Fairhill 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?

The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in Fairhill is currently 817 sq ft.
